Recap: Cedar Park Christian Eagles vs. Morton/White Pass Timberwolves

On Saturday, The Cedar Park Christian Eagles got themselves on the board against the Morton/White Pass Timberwolves, but the Morton/White Pass Timberwolves never followed suit. They simply couldn't be stopped as they easily beat the Timberwolves 39-0 on the road. The match was all but wrapped up at the end of the third, by which point Cedar Park Christian had established a 32 point advantage.

Lyal Viers was the offensive standout of the match as he rushed for 122 yards and two touchdowns on only 14 carries. Another player making a difference was Andy Penrod, who threw for 156 yards and two touchdowns.

The victory makes it two in a row for Cedar Park Christian and bumps their season record up to 5-3. Those good results were due in large part to their offensive dominance across that stretch, as they averaged 31.0 points per game. As for Morton/White Pass, they are on a six-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 1-7.

Cedar Park Christian will head out on the road to face off against King's at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. King's will be looking to keep their four-game home win streak alive. Morton/White Pass will take on Raymond-South Bend at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day.
